The Farmers Inn, Presteigne
A warm, traditional pub and inn in Presteigne offering hearty food, cozy rooms, and a welcoming countryside atmosphere.
The Farmers Inn is a charming traditional pub and inn located at 1 Hereford Street in Presteigne, Powys. Renowned for its warm, welcoming atmosphere and hearty, well-prepared food, it offers a quintessentially British countryside experience. With a strong local following and a reputation for generous portions and quality ales, it is a favored spot for both locals and visitors exploring the Welsh borders.

A Historic Countryside Pub with Local Charm
Nestled in the heart of Presteigne, The Farmers Inn embodies the spirit of a classic British rural pub. Its setting on Hereford Street places it within easy reach of the town’s quaint streets and scenic surroundings. The inn’s character is defined by its traditional décor and friendly ambiance, making it a comforting retreat after a day of exploring the Welsh borders.Hearty Cuisine and Welcoming Service
The Farmers Inn is celebrated for its straightforward yet satisfying menu, featuring local and seasonal ingredients. Signature dishes such as the minted lamb burger and generous fish burgers have garnered praise for their quality and flavor. The pub’s carvery and basket meals offer excellent value, served in a relaxed environment with attentive staff who contribute to the inn’s inviting atmosphere.Accommodation with a Homely Feel
Beyond the pub, The Farmers Inn provides cozy and clean accommodations for travelers seeking an authentic countryside stay. Guests appreciate the quiet, comfortable rooms that complement the overall warm hospitality. This blend of lodging and dining makes it a convenient base for visitors touring the region.Community Hub and Social Venue
Serving as more than just a place to eat and sleep, The Farmers Inn functions as a social hub within Presteigne. It attracts a diverse crowd, from locals enjoying a pint to travelers and motorbike riders exploring the borders. The pub’s lively yet relaxed vibe encourages convivial gatherings and a sense of community.Location and Surroundings
Situated in Powys, the inn benefits from the tranquil beauty of the Welsh countryside. The nearby landscapes offer opportunities for scenic walks, nature appreciation, and cultural exploration. The Farmers Inn acts as a welcoming gateway to these experiences, providing comfort and refreshment in a picturesque setting.Enduring Appeal and Local Reputation
With a strong rating and positive recognition, The Farmers Inn has established itself as a reliable choice for quality food and hospitality in Presteigne. Its combination of traditional charm, hearty fare, and genuine service continues to attract repeat visitors and new patrons alike.Iconic landmarks you can’t miss
